Scriptures, The
Given by inspiration of God - 2Ti 3:16
Given by inspiration of the Holy Spirit - Ac 1:16; Heb 3:7; 2Pe 1:21
Christ sanctioned, by appealing to them - Mt 4:4; Mr 12:10; Joh 7:42
Christ taught out of - Lu 24:27
ARE CALLED THE
Contain the promises of the gospel - Ro 1:2
Reveal the laws, statutes, and judgments of God - De 4:5,14; Ex 24:3,4
Record divine prophecies - 2Pe 1:19-21
Testify of Christ - Joh 5:39; Ac 10:43; 18:28; 1Co 15:3
Are full and sufficient - Lu 16:29,31
Are an unerring guide - Pr 6:23; 2Pe 1:19
Are able to make wise to salvation through faith in Christ Jesus - 2Ti 3:15
Are profitable both for doctrine and practice - 2Ti 3:16,17
DESCRIBED AS
Written for our instruction - Ro 15:4
Intended for the use of all men - Ro 16:26
Nothing to be taken from, or added to - De 4:2; 12:32
One portion of, to be compared with another - 1Co 2:13
DESIGNED FOR
Work effectually in them that believe - 1Th 2:13
The letter of, without the spirit, killeth - Joh 6:63; 2Co 3:6
Ignorance of, a source of error - Mt 22:29; Ac 13:27
Christ enables us to understand - Lu 24:45
The Holy Spirit enable us to understand - Joh 16:13; 1Co 2:10-14
No prophecy of, is of any private interpretation - 2Pe 1:20
Everything should be tried by - Isa 8:20; Ac 17:11
SHOULD BE
All should desire to hear - Ne 8:1
Mere hearers of, deceive themselves - Jas 1:22
Advantage of possessing - Ro 3:2
